Finding an ideal family-friendly resort in Trstena does not have to be difficult. Welcome to Oravsky Haj Garden Hotel & Resort, a nice option for travellers like you.

Oravsky Haj Garden Hotel & Resort is a family-friendly resort offering a kitchenette in the rooms, and it is easy to stay connected during your stay as free wifi is offered to guests.

The resort features newspaper, a gift shop, and outdoor furniture. Plus, guests can enjoy a pool and free breakfast, which have made this a popular choice among travellers visiting Trstena. For guests with a vehicle, free parking is available.

While you’re here, be sure to check out Cukráreň Halimi, one of the cafes that can be found in Trstena, which is a short distance from Oravsky Haj Garden Hotel & Resort.

The location of the resort is amongst fields so is peaceful and relaxed. You will need a car to sample the surrounding attractions - Orava Castle, West Tatras which are both definitely worth visiting. We visited in early September with my wife, her parents and 9 month old. Resort is baby friendly! The resort is relatively new and accommodations are clean and modern in traditional style. Other facilities include great new wellness centre with pool / sauna / steam room / jacuzzi / massage. There is also a games room - pool / table tennis / air hockey as well as baby / toddler area. On top of this the grounds of the resort include large grassed area with benches, play equipment, fire pit area, bbq area which would be wonderful in warm weather. The service was friendly - special mention should go to Nina in the restaurant who won over our 9 month old with her friendliness and attention! Thank you :) We would not hesitate to recommend and will probably return. Ps An outdoor pool area was under construction when we were there - adding further facility...

Very good hotel resort near Trstená and Poland. There are consist of six homes with appartments ( 4-6 in each) which have name like a Disney heroes and one home where is reception and restaurant and home where is wellness . In resort is also horses with possibility to ride. Appartments are very nice , some of them are new and modern and some of them are in traditional style ( I like in this traditional style). Very nice is trip to Zakopane in Poland (1 hour drive) this is centrum of winter sport and activities and it is known of many restaurants and shops. In winter there are mamy ski centrums near hotel ( Brezovica, Vitanova, Oravice,Nižná)
